A private detective, also known as a private investigator, is a professional who is hired to conduct investigations and gather information on behalf of individuals, businesses, or organizations. They work independently or as part of a private investigation agency and are often hired to uncover hidden truths, solve mysteries, or gather evidence for legal purposes.
Private detectives use various methods to gather information, such as conducting surveillance, interviewing witnesses, and researching public records. They may specialize in different areas, including criminal investigations, background checks, infidelity cases, or corporate fraud. Private detectives may also be called upon to testify in court or provide their findings to clients.

Private Detective salary in Spain
Average Yearly Salary of Private Detective in Spain is approximately 31,515 EUR (31,489 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Is Private Detective a well paid job?
Yes, our data show that Private Detective is an averagely well paid job that still allows for some yearly savings. With years and experience the salary might increase even further, resulting in higher satisfaction.What is considered a high salary for Private Detective?
High salary for Private Detective would be somewhere between 34,667 EUR and 45,697 EUR. However this is an estimation based on Gaussian Distribution.How much can you save working as Private Detective in Spain?
Living in Spain the approximate monthly expenses are: 1,267 USD. This amount covers basic needs such as food, housing, clothing, healthcare and education costs for a single person.
